Claregalway Weather: What to Expect Year-Round

Claregalway experiences a temperate maritime climate, characterized by mild temperatures and frequent rainfall throughout the year. The best times to visit are late spring and early autumn when the weather is generally pleasant, allowing for enjoyable exploration of the area.

Useful tips for bus travellers
• To ensure a smooth start to your journey, double-check the bus schedule at Burkesbus before your departure, as frequencies can sometimes vary, especially during holidays or weekends.
• Make sure to arrive at Eyre Square at least 10-15 minutes before your bus departs, as this area can get busy and it may take time to find your bus on the platform; look for the Burkesbus sign specifically.
• Upon arrival at Claregalway station, head towards the small bus shelter just outside where local taxis usually wait—this is your best bet for getting a quick ride to nearby accommodations or amenities.
